National Identity Representation
The red, white, and blue color scheme is frequently adopted to represent national identity, often linked to specific historical events or national values. For instance, the French tricolor, featuring blue, white, and red, has been a symbol of France for centuries, reflecting its revolutionary history and ideals of liberty, equality, and fraternity. Similarly, the American flag’s use of red, white, and blue has come to represent American values and national identity.

Varying Interpretations Across Cultures
The interpretation of red, white, and blue can differ across various cultural contexts. In some cultures, red might symbolize passion and energy, while in others, it might represent danger or misfortune. Similarly, white can represent purity and peace in one culture, while in another, it might represent mourning or death. Blue, in some instances, may represent calmness or spirituality, whereas in others, it may signify melancholy.
These varying connotations emphasize the importance of understanding the specific cultural context in which these colors are used. Design Impact on Performance
Cleat design is meticulously crafted to optimize performance in various playing conditions. Different playing surfaces require different designs. For example, cleats for grass fields typically feature studs that provide excellent grip, while those for artificial turf might have a different pattern to ensure stability. Cleat designs also reflect the specific demands of different sports. Soccer cleats, for instance, prioritize agility and quick changes in direction.
These intricate details can significantly impact an athlete’s performance. Consideration of these design factors is crucial for peak performance.
